What a great idea this is ! Not a lot of spectators, but tons of participants, and so a great opportunity for week-end racers to have a crack at The Mountain. I had to work for some of the week-end, but slipped down for a few hours on Saturday with my nephew (who is also a car-nut, and working on making a living from it). He took some pics, including of Forum member David Towe, buzzing down thru the Esses. I will try to work out how to post them on here.
A great variety of cars, awsome to hear all the different engines cutting down the Mount - makes you all nostalgic for the days when the Great Race had more than 2 different engines ! Mind you, the top nostalgia prize, for me, was seeing the 1990 Bathurst winning VL (or a terrific replica) belting down the Mount - the driver was giving it heaps, and it sounded oh so on song. David's BMW was harder to hear, as he was busy with an A9X and a Group C Commo. Also found the Porsche 935 and 911 GT-1 98, hiding in the Firey's camp shed. Fantastic - will go for more time next year. Highly recommended to petrol heads.

The post above is from a year ago....... 12 months goes by so quickly these days.....and things move on, too. The afore said Nephew is there this year, working with one of the FFord teams (they won the two FF races yesterday); and I have since learned to post pictures on this Forum (LOL).
Still virtually no spectators, despite no actual admission charge (you can/should make a donation at the Gate to the Cancer Council), and despite having the freedom to go wherever you wish at this iconic track - it's a bit dfferent to being there for the "1000", that's for sure.
If you have a car that can enter any of the events, including a Regularity, it is a great chance to have a fang around this awesome track. Anyway, here's a scattered selection of Pics from yesterday (Saturday), to give some idea what the event is like.
